I'm an adult driver who only had experience with right-hand drive a month ago, but thanks to Beckham and Long, I managed to pass the DMV driving test on my first try today (27 May 2022).
I started my instruction with Beckham who is very experienced with driving and knows the ins-and-outs of the testing process. The instruction was very well organized. Each lesson was 2 hours ($60/hour) and Beckham was very efficient with the planning the route and pickup/dropoff locations so that I got as much time as possible behind the wheel. The first few lessons involved driving around small roads near the La Jolla neighborhood, but eventually they progress towards the DMV testing area. Very frequently I got to drive on the freeway even though that was not part of the test. Sometimes we also picked up other students at various locations and there were good learning opportunities when driving at unfamiliar locations.
Beckham is very honest with you and pretty friendly during instruction. Sometimes he prepares snacks for you during the break. However, he can be quite strict if you make mistakes, especially near the test site. It is a good thing when trying to optimize for testing conditions. In addition, Beckham also plans your lessons and schedules the test at a date, time and location that is optimized for you to pass. The level of planning and personalization that goes into scheduling does shows the amount of dedication he has to ensure his students' success during the test.
Closer to the date of my driving test, I got Long (Beckham's brother) as my instructor. My lessons with Long were mostly driving around the test area and fine tuning my driving skills for the test. Long is also very friendly and pretty chill. Like Beckham, he will also point out your mistakes so that you can learn from them.
Overall, Beckham and Long are a great team of instructors and I would highly recommend if you are looking to pass your driving test.
